## Rural Towns Fight Back Against AI Data Center Invasions

Rural communities across Michigan and Utah are discovering that local democracy has limits when confronting well-funded tech corporations. In Michigan, [a farm town voted down plans for a giant OpenAI-Oracle data center, but weeks later construction began anyway](https://finance.yahoo.com/economy/policy/articles/michigan-farm-town-voted-down-070000429.html), revealing the weakness of local zoning enforcement against corporate determination.

The situation in Utah presents an even more dramatic example of corporate overreach. [Kevin O'Leary's massive data center project received approval despite fierce local opposition](https://gizmodo.com/kevin-olearys-massive-data-center-project-in-utah-gets-the-greenlight-locals-are-furious-2000755168), with the proposed facility spanning more than twice the size of Manhattan and potentially consuming more electricity than the entire state currently uses. Local residents express frustration at being excluded from meaningful input on projects that will fundamentally alter their communities' character and resource availability.

The AI infrastructure boom represents a new form of extractive industry for rural America, where communities provide land and resources while receiving minimal long-term benefits. Unlike traditional industries that employed local workers, these automated facilities require few permanent employees but place enormous demands on electrical grids and water systems. The projects proceed with minimal environmental review and often override local zoning regulations through state-level interventions.

Rural communities are beginning to organize more sophisticated resistance strategies, recognizing that traditional town hall meetings and local votes may be insufficient against corporate legal teams and political influence. Some are exploring regional coalitions and seeking support from environmental justice organizations to challenge these projects in federal court. The outcome of these battles will determine whether rural communities can maintain meaningful control over their development trajectory or become passive recipients of corporate infrastructure decisions.

## Solar Farms Enable Cattle Ranching Income Diversification

Agrivoltaic technology is emerging as a practical solution for farmers facing the billion-dollar decline in US agricultural revenues. In Tennessee, innovative farmers are demonstrating how cattle ranching can coexist with solar energy production through carefully designed systems that benefit both livestock and renewable energy generation. These installations use adjustable solar panels that can be raised or lowered based on weather conditions and grazing needs.

The integration relies on sophisticated software-controlled sensors that monitor livestock behavior, grass growth, and energy production simultaneously. Cattle benefit from shade during hot weather while solar panels gain efficiency from the cooling effect of grass growth beneath them. This dual-use approach maximizes land productivity without sacrificing either agricultural or energy output.

For rural landowners, agrivoltaic systems provide crucial income diversification during a period of agricultural economic stress. Traditional crop and livestock operations face pressure from climate volatility, input cost inflation, and market consolidation. Solar leasing arrangements offer predictable, long-term income streams that complement rather than replace agricultural activities.

The model addresses common rural concerns about solar development by preserving agricultural land use rather than converting farmland to industrial purposes. Farmers maintain their livestock operations while generating additional revenue from renewable energy production. Early adopters report that cattle adapt quickly to the infrastructure and may actually prefer the shaded grazing areas during summer months.

Success of these projects depends on careful site planning that considers local soil conditions, drainage patterns, and livestock behavior. The technology represents a significant advancement over traditional ground-mounted solar installations that typically preclude agricultural use. As more farmers observe successful implementations, agrivoltaic adoption is expected to accelerate across rural regions seeking sustainable income diversification strategies.

## Pollinator Protection Links Rural Health to Economic Resilience

New research provides concrete economic justification for pollinator conservation efforts, [quantifying the health and income benefits that pollinators provide to rural communities](https://www.npr.org/2026/05/06/nx-s1-5807663/preserving-pollinators-is-good-for-health-and-income). The study demonstrates measurable connections between bee populations, agricultural productivity, and human nutritional outcomes.

Pollinators contribute significantly to crop yields for fruits, vegetables, and nuts that provide essential nutrients in human diets. The research shows that regions with declining pollinator populations experience reduced availability of nutrient-dense foods, leading to measurable health impacts in rural communities that depend on local food production.

For farmers, the economic case for pollinator protection has become increasingly clear as crop yields directly correlate with pollinator abundance. Bee populations support not only commercial crops but also home gardens and small-scale agricultural operations that contribute to household food security. The economic value extends beyond direct crop production to include ecosystem services that support soil health and plant diversity.

Rural entrepreneurs are discovering business opportunities in pollinator conservation through native plant nurseries, pollinator habitat restoration services, and honey production operations. These ventures create local employment while supporting agricultural productivity throughout their regions.

The research provides rural communities with science-backed arguments for environmental policies that protect pollinator habitat. Local governments can use this data to justify zoning decisions, pesticide regulations, and land use planning that prioritizes biodiversity conservation alongside economic development.

Conservation efforts require coordinated action across rural landscapes, creating opportunities for regional collaboration among farmers, land managers, and conservation organizations. Successful programs combine habitat creation, sustainable farming practices, and community education to support both pollinator populations and agricultural resilience.

## Rising Bee Theft Threatens Rural Agricultural Economies

Agricultural crime has evolved into sophisticated operations targeting high-value rural assets, with [bee theft escalating into a million-dollar black market that threatens pollinator availability](https://gizmodo.com/police-looking-for-jerks-who-allegedly-stole-150000-worth-of-beehives-2000755716). A recent theft valued at $150,000 demonstrates the scale and organization of criminal operations targeting rural apiaries.

Professional bee thieves operate with detailed knowledge of apiary locations, hive values, and transportation logistics. They target operations during peak season when bee populations are highest and pollination services command premium prices. The theft impacts extend beyond immediate financial losses to disrupted pollination contracts and reduced agricultural productivity across affected regions.

Rural security infrastructure often lacks the sophistication needed to protect against organized agricultural crime. Remote apiary locations make detection difficult, while rural law enforcement agencies may lack specialized knowledge about agricultural assets and markets. The crimes often cross jurisdictional boundaries, complicating investigation and prosecution efforts.

Beekeepers are implementing GPS tracking systems, security cameras, and community alert networks to protect their operations. Some are forming cooperatives that share security costs and coordinate monitoring efforts across regional networks. These community-based approaches leverage local knowledge and mutual assistance to supplement formal law enforcement.

The black market for stolen bees reflects broader trends in agricultural crime that target high-value, easily transportable rural assets. Similar operations focus on farm equipment, livestock, and specialty crops that can be quickly converted to cash through established networks.

Insurance coverage for bee theft remains limited, leaving many beekeepers to absorb losses directly. The industry is advocating for better rural crime reporting systems and specialized law enforcement training that recognizes the economic importance of pollinator protection.

## PFAS Contamination Crisis Hits Rural Landfill Communities

Rural North Carolina communities are confronting decades of environmental contamination from "forever chemicals" that persist in soil and water systems. [A grassroots nonprofit is fighting back against PFAS contamination](https://grist.org/sponsored/rural-north-carolina-fights-back-against-pfas-contamination-ejcan/) that has created environmental justice issues in agricultural regions surrounding massive landfill operations.

The contamination pattern reflects a common dynamic where rural areas become dumping grounds for national waste streams, with environmental costs concentrated in communities that lack political influence to resist unwanted facilities. PFAS chemicals accumulate in groundwater and agricultural soils, creating long-term health risks for farming families and contaminating food production systems.

Rural communities often discover contamination years after exposure begins, when health impacts become apparent and testing reveals widespread environmental damage. The delayed recognition reflects limited environmental monitoring in rural areas and regulatory systems that focus on urban industrial sites rather than rural waste facilities.

Grassroots advocacy organizations are building technical expertise to challenge contamination sources and demand accountability from waste management companies and regulatory agencies. These efforts require sustained community organizing and collaboration with environmental justice advocates who can provide legal and technical support.

The health consequences fall disproportionately on rural residents who depend on well water and local food production systems. Children and pregnant women face particular risks from PFAS exposure, creating public health emergencies that rural healthcare systems are often unprepared to address.

Legal strategies focus on compelling cleanup efforts and preventing additional contamination from expanding landfill operations. However, PFAS remediation technology remains limited and expensive, making community advocacy essential for protecting rural populations from ongoing exposure.
